Car Key Battery Replacement

If your car key fob is not working, you may have dead or low batteries. It is simple to replace a key fob battery in your car at home.

First, determine what kind of battery your device requires. The majority are 3 Volt or CR2025 batteries that can be found in hardware stores and electronic retailers.

Modern cars are equipped with key fobs, which include a battery. The most popular key fob for car battery replacement is a CR2032 battery, which is cheap and easy to find in stores like Batteries Plus.

To change the batteries inside your key fob you will have to open it. The majority of key fobs come with a clamshell design, with two halves which snap together. Most times, you can open up the key fob using a butter knife or your fingernail. Certain key fobs are more difficult to open and require a screwdriver.

When the two halves are separated, you can see the circuit board as well as the battery. Be sure not to loose any screws or wires in the process. Take a photo or write down the location of the battery that was used in the key fob to ensure you can replace it in the same way.

Insert the new battery in the same spot as the previous one. Check whether the new battery is both positive and negative. Once the battery has been installed, you can place the circuit board over it and then snap back the two halves together.

First, you'll need to locate the old battery. There is a symbol on the back or top of the battery, which is easily accessible with a magnifying glass. You can also consult the owner's manual for your vehicle or ask someone from the service department of your dealership to help you identify the kind of battery you need.

It's time to replace the battery you've had since you've found it! With a flat screwdriver or a coin, gently open the fob along the seam. Be careful not to damage the plastic casing or any electronic components within. After opening the fob, be sure to remove any old batteries. Note which side is positive and which is the negative side, so you can insert the new battery exactly in the same way.

The first step is to determine what type of battery your key fob requires. You will find the information in your vehicle's manual or in the part department at the dealership. Once you've identified the type of battery that you need, you can purchase it from a general store or an auto parts store. Make sure that the new battery is the exact size as the old one and that it is put in into the correct direction.

To put in the new battery make sure you carefully insert it into the key fob that is now open. Be careful not to scratch the circuit board or any other internal components when you do this. Make sure that the positive side of the new battery is facing up since this is what gives it the power to charge. After you have put the battery in then you can close the keyfob and then reinstall the circuit board. Snap both sides together.

After resealing the fob you can then test it to ensure that all of the buttons function just as they should. Press each button on the fob to check if it responds. You're ready to go if everything works properly! If you are still experiencing issues, you might have to reopen your fob and double-check the battery's orientation.

First, you'll need to open the fob that holds the key. This step may vary depending on the manufacturer, however generally, you'll need a flat screwdriver in order to break away the fob along the seam. You must be cautious to avoid damaging any internal components when opening your key fob.

Remove the battery after you've opened the fob. It should be able to pop out easily thanks to an internal spring However, if it doesn't, try using more than one location around the fob and apply gentle pressure. Place the new battery into its compartment, and ensure it is in the right orientation.

You can find the button cell battery in most auto accessory stores, home improvement stores, and general stores. Alternately, you can buy them from online retailers like Amazon.

You'll need to close your key fob once again after replacing the battery. It's a good idea test the lock and unlock as well as start functions to ensure they're working correctly. If you notice that they're not functioning, it could be beneficial to have the key fob programmed by a locksmith.
